Use case
Stripe is set to a merchant’s account and used by the fabric storefront to process payments during checkout. The fabric checkout experience calls Stripe to authorize, process, refund, or void payments.Available actions
- Authorize payments
 - Get payment
 - Capture payment
 - Refund payment
 - Void payment
 - Create customer
 - Create payment
 - Get customer
 - Generate client token
 
Set up the Stripe connector in your fabric account
- Complete the setup and activation for your Stripe account
 - Submit a support request to fabric customer success with the following details:
 - Provide the following payment settings values:
 
| Setting | Description | Value | 
|---|---|---|
| Auto capture authorization | Indicates if the capture should be performed in the authorization request. The Auto_Capture default is off. | on/off | 
| Payment method deleted after authorization | Indicates if the payment token should be kept or invalidated for later uses. The KEEP_TOKEN default value is set to perform the token invalidation. This is so guest users can be handled by the connector. | on/off |
